Portál AbcLinuxu, 10. května 2025 12:23
('a', 'bb', 'c')a
('ab', 'b', 'c')
select count(*) from ( select distinct column1, column2, column3 from some_table )
Ne nedá, count( distinct x )
je v principu dvojitá agregace. Přímo v SQL kromě zmíněného distinct není dvojitá agregace zabudována.
Buď si přestanete házet klacky pod nohy (=JPA), nebo vám není pomoci.
Tiskni
Sdílej:
ISSN 1214-1267, (c) 1999-2007 Stickfish s.r.o.